Gucci Mane has been ordered to pay $60,000 in punitive damages to a woman that he pushed out of a moving car in 2011.

According to TMZ, victim Diana Graham was pushed out of a moving Hummer after she refused to go to a hotel room with the Southern rapper. Gooch plead guilty to the charges and was sentenced to six months behind bars.

Graham then sued the “Lemonade” spitter for damages including mental anguish, pain and emotional distress. A Georgia judge ruled in her favor by default because Gucci failed to appear in court and gave false testimony, and signed an order allowing her to go after the rapper’s material assets to settle her debt.
